Hormonal Foundations of Performance

Central to this vitality is the endocrine system. Hormones like testosterone, estrogen, growth hormone, and thyroid hormones orchestrate myriad bodily functions, from metabolic rate and muscle synthesis to cognitive acuity and mood regulation. As individuals progress through life, the natural ebb in these critical signaling molecules can lead to diminished energy, altered body composition, reduced libido, and a blunting of mental sharpness.

Hormone Optimization Protocols

Restoring hormonal balance forms a primary pillar. For men, this often involves Testosterone Replacement Therapy (TRT), administered via injections or transdermal methods, to bring levels into an optimal physiological range. For women, hormone strategies can involve tailored estrogen, progesterone, and testosterone regimens, addressing perimenopausal and menopausal shifts to maintain mood, bone density, and sexual function.

Beyond sex hormones, thyroid hormone optimization, when indicated by bloodwork and symptoms, is essential for metabolic regulation and energy. Supplementation with precursors like DHEA or pregnenolone can also play a role in fortifying the endocrine cascade.

The Power of Peptides

Peptides represent a sophisticated frontier in biological optimization. These short chains of amino acids act as signaling molecules, instructing cells to perform specific functions. For vitality, peptides such as GHRPs (Growth Hormone Releasing Peptides) and GHRH (Growth Hormone Releasing Hormone) analogs, like Sermorelin or Ipamorelin, stimulate the pituitary gland to release growth hormone.

This can aid in tissue repair, body composition enhancement, and improved sleep quality. Other peptides, like BPC-157, are recognized for their potent healing and regenerative properties, supporting joint health and recovery.

Metabolic System Tuning

Fine-tuning the metabolic system is paramount. This involves a dual approach ∞ precise nutritional strategies and optimized exercise regimens. Nutritional plans are tailored to individual metabolic profiles, emphasizing whole foods, adequate protein intake for muscle synthesis, and healthy fats. Strategies such as intermittent fasting or time-restricted eating can enhance insulin sensitivity and cellular repair processes.

Exercise programming integrates resistance training to build and maintain muscle mass ∞ a critical factor in metabolic health and strength ∞ with cardiovascular conditioning for heart health and endurance, and potentially high-intensity interval training (HIIT) for metabolic efficiency.

Sleep and Stress Management Architectures

The architecture of sleep and stress response is fundamental to recovery and overall hormonal balance. Optimizing sleep hygiene ∞ consistent timing, dark environment, appropriate temperature ∞ allows for critical hormonal release and cellular repair. Managing the body’s stress response, primarily through techniques that modulate the sympathetic and parasympathetic nervous systems, prevents chronic cortisol elevation, which can wreak havoc on metabolism, cognition, and immune function. This involves mindful practices, breathwork, and adequate recovery periods.
